Transaction 6b8cc2090bb0633c00a7fee9d82f82229b000892fc6c3a16fe23ef629fa69822

3 Input
1 Outputs
  • 6b8cc2090bb0633c00a7fee9d82f82229b000892fc6c3a16fe23ef629fa69822:0
  • value  1347976
    address  3PyAv6bE8CHRm4DG8buYpzkSRePd8gAjg1